How do the QRA IFDs differ from previous IFDs?

The updated QRA IFDs were finalised in April 2025 and use a larger dataset than previous estimates, including data through the end of 2023. The IFDs are adjusted to a dataset midpoint of 2010 in accordance with the ARR version 4.2 rainfall factors. The methodology differs from previous IFD datasets and is described in the full report.

Background

Following the 2022 floods in South East Queensland, the Queensland Reconstruction Authority (QRA) commissioned HARC to review and revise design rainfall intensity data (IFD) for South East Queensland.

The study area covers the local government areas of:

  • Brisbane City Council
  • Bundaberg Regional Council
  • Cherbourg Aboriginal Shire
  • Fraser Coast Regional Council
  • Gold Coast City Council
  • Gympie Regional Council
  • Ipswich City Council
  • Lockyer Valley Regional Council
  • Logan City Council
  • Moreton Bay City Council
  • Noosa Shire Council
  • North Burnett Regional Council
  • Redland City Council
  • Scenic Rim Regional Council
  • Somerset Regional Council
  • South Burnett Regional Council
  • Sunshine Coast Regional
  • Toowoomba Regional Council
  • Parts of Western Downs Regional Council

The updated IFD data includes all 24 standard rainfall burst durations between 5 minutes and 7 days and for all standard annual exceedance probabilities (AEP) between 63% and 1 in 2,000 AEP. Frequency analysis was undertaken on daily and sub-daily rainfall gauge data from 1,377 rainfall gauges and then regionalised and spatially interpolated to produce sets of design IFD grids. The updated data were corrected to allow for the progressive influence of climate change over the rainfall data period and guidance was provided with the data for practitioners to adjust the grids for projected climate change, applying the latest DCCEEW (2024) federal draft of the Climate Change Considerations Chapter of ARR.
